Your opportunity

An opportunity exists for a Finance Director who brings strong strategic and business operational acumen, exceptional communication skills, and the ability to influence through their collaborative leadership style. As a key partner to the North America Business Operating Unit (BOU) leadership team, this role will provide end-to-end financial leadership, shaping the performance and long-term success of a complex organization spanning thousands of projects and employees.

The ideal candidate will be an operationally and commercially minded finance & accounting professional with extensive experience in a professional services (ideally engineering consulting) environment. 

We are seeking an individual who is capable of high-level strategic thinking whilst also being able to roll up their sleeves when required to ensure smooth operation of key business processes across a diverse business portfolio.

Your key responsibilities 

  • Partner with the North America Business Operating Unit leadership team to drive operational excellence. 
  • Lead the development and delivery of strategic reporting, advanced analytics, and actionable insights to senior leadership, identifying performance issues and driving cross-functional mitigation plans and continuous improvement initiatives.
  • Successfully lead, manage, and mentor a team of finance managers and financial analysts; coach and inspire the team to be extraordinary business partners to operations.
  • Responsible for the overall talent management lifecycle of finance managers and analysts, including career development, employee engagement, succession planning, coaching and mentoring, diversity and inclusion and leadership development.
  • Lead various ad hoc analysis, such as: develop business cases, in partnership with BOU leadership, for strategic initiatives; assess indirect labor spending and provide action plan recommendations to optimize performance; develop price and costing models and strategies to support operations on large and complex project bids, including those with KPI bonuses and joint ventures/arrangements.
  • Facilitate, drive and coordinate BOU quarterly rolling forecasting, and annual budgeting processes.
  • Establish financial services best practices specific to the needs of the BOU and appropriately coordinate the roll out and change management aspects to the implementation of these best practices.
  • Develop and deliver financial literacy training for various audiences throughout Finance and the BOU based on identified needs.
  • Champion DSO improvement within the BOU and coordinate with Finance Managers, Project Accounting and operations leadership as appropriate.
  • Develop and deliver financial acumen training for BCOLs, BLs and other BOU leaders as required
  • Coordinate FS involvement in acquisition operational due diligence and integration planning, support, and financial training for individuals joining from the acquired company.
  • Provide financial expertise and oversight on governance calls on major projects
  • Drive BOU activities related to external and internal (SOX) audit processes.
  • Ensure a reliable system of internal controls are in place to adequately safeguard the company assets and provide with integrity accurate reporting on financial results.
  • Foster, a proficient project management culture to improve company results and ensure strong project accounting and revenue (PAR) internal controls.

Pay Transparency: In compliance with pay transparency laws, pay ranges are provided for positions in locations where required. Please note, the final agreed upon compensation is based on individual education, qualifications, experience, and work location. At Stantec certain roles are bonus eligible. Actual compensation for part-time roles will be pro-rated based on the agreed number of working hours per week.

Benefits Summary: Regular full-time and part-time employees (working at least 20 hours per week) will have access to health, dental, and vision plans, a wellness program, health care spending account, wellness spending account, group registered retirement savings plan, employee stock purchase program, group tax-free savings account, life and accidental death & dismemberment (AD&D) insurance, short-term/long-term disability plans, emergency travel benefits, tuition reimbursement, professional membership fee coverage, and paid time off.

Temporary/casual employees will have access to group registered retirement savings plan, employee stock purchase program, and group tax-free savings account.

The benefits information listed above may not apply to union positions because benefits for such positions are governed by applicable collective bargaining agreements.
